2009 Maternity Fashion Trends and Tips

Look and Feel Your (Pregnant) Best in 2009
Tips from Celebrity Fashion Fave, Skye Hoppus

Momma, I know you’re a smart gal. You’ve come this far and luck had very little to do with it!

Times are tough but remember, you are the pillar of strength in your family and now is the time to kick it into high gear and be the best you for your family and yourself.

Feeling the pressure? Remember that being a ROCK STAR MOMMA is truly a state of mind and not just about looking fabulous. Here and now is the time to shine and I’ve got a few tricks to help you be your best.

Rock Star Momma Tip #1
Looking good means feeling good

As you know, pregnant or not (but especially when you’re pregnant), when you look great, you feel great. And momma, it’s really not that hard, regardless of the type of budget you’re working with. Think about it: what pieces in your closet are you loving at the moment? Is it the boot cut jeans that elongate your legs, or the day dress that makes you feel like you’ve just transcended into the set of Breakfast at Tiffany’s?

Try these easy looks that work well on any budget and for most every body type:

Leggings with an amazing tunic and exaggerated belt. Thankfully, the babydoll shaped dresses of 2008 are on their way out and cinched waists are back in! This look is great when paired with patent leather ballet flats.

Strong silhouettes are going to be big in ‘09. Say goodbye to maxi dressing and hello to more structured cuts. You should be wearing your outfit rather than your outfit wearing you!

Colorize yourself. Take those favorite black jeans and pair them with a bright, bold printed blouse or tee.

Better basics. Stick with your favorite simple looks. Sometimes, less is definitely more. (I can’t believe I just said that!)
